![]() US President Donald Trump said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y "has to be realistic" about the war and questioned when Ukraine intends to hold its next elections. "I think he has to be realistic, And I wonder about, how long is it going to be till they have an election? It's a long time. They haven't had an election in a long time. It's losing a lot of people. And it's possible that the people, if you look at the polls, I will say 82%...there was a poll came out 82% of the people are demanding a settlement be made. Ukrainian people, they want to see a settlement be made. I understand that." he said. |
